How they compare

Cameroon currently reports 38.6% against 37.2% in Gambia, a difference of 1.4%.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 13 shared years of data; in 2011 it was Gambia ahead.

Cameroon ranks 14th and Gambia ranks 16th of 166 countries.

Across the 2 decades both report, Cameroon averaged higher in 1 and Gambia in 1.
